What Changed

Anthropic's Claude Mythos has solved the Unit-Distance Conjecture, a mathematical problem that had been unresolved since 1946, soon after OpenAI's similar claim. This marks the first instance of multiple AI entities nearly simultaneously resolving a significant mathematical challenge. In the context of AI achievements, such events underscore a rising trend of AI's role in mathematical innovation.
